Tree Plantation Campaign Organised in Puri to Encourage Community Participation in Nature Conservation

Puri, Sept 17 [UDN}:Odisha Health Minister Dr. Mukesh Mahaling participated in a tree plantation programme at Lok Bhavan in Puri in the presence of Odisha Governor Dr. Hari Babu Kambhampati and Member of Parliament Dr. Sambit Patra.

The plantation drive was organised as part of the “Ek Ped Maa Ke Naam” (One Tree in the Name of Mother) campaign, launched following the call of Prime Minister Narendra Modi to encourage people across the country to contribute to environmental protection through tree plantation.

The campaign aims to promote greater awareness about the importance of trees, protect the environment and encourage citizens to actively participate in creating a greener and healthier future.
